## Step‑by‑Step: Build Your Own Dad‑and‑Me Activity Book

1. **Pick a theme** your child loves—dinosaurs, space, or baking.  
2. **Download the free printable template** (link below) and print it on standard paper.  
3. **Cut the pages** along the dotted lines; the template already includes spaces for drawing, puzzles, and short prompts.  
4. **Bind the book** with a staple, ribbon, or a simple ring binder.  

Because the template is **reusable**, you can swap out theme pages and create a fresh book whenever inspiration strikes.
